Hop til indhold
  • 0

IHC Alarm integration i Homeassistant


Morten Dalsgaard
 Share

Spørgsmål

8 svar på dette spørgsmål

Recommended Posts

  • 0

Ja, det kan du sagtens via manuel alarm komponent i HA. Se link

Vær dog opmærksom på, at skalsikring i IHC alarm modulet er en toogle. Du skal lave en smule logik i HA for at tvinge den hhv. on og off. Totalalarm i IHC har allerede direkte on og off pulser.

Jeg har dette kørende i flere år side om side med openHAB og Homekit. Så man selv vælge bedste UI :-)

Link til kommentar
Del på andre sites

  • 0

Tak for svar. Jeg har været inde og kigge, men når jeg vælger mit alarmpanel, er der ikke et Entity jeg kan vælge. Er det fordi jeg skal ændre noget in min configuration.yaml.

Jeg kan ikke rigtig gennemskue hvordan jeg får Alarmdelen synlig i HA.  En lille note. så har jeg kun alarm på pir sensor og ikke kontat på døre og vinduer. Her bruger jeg Sonoff men hænger ikke sammen med min IHC alarm og benyttes kun for visuel at se om alle døre og vinduer er lukket.

 

Link til kommentar
Del på andre sites

  • 0

Hej Ejvin Hald

Kunne du ikke give et par eksempler på din kode, da vi ikke alle er lige gode til at kode og kunne virkelig godt bruge nogle eksemplar som ville kunne hjælpe os i at guide os den rette vej i forhold til hvordan det skal se ud med IHC alarm? :-)
På forhånd tak.

Link til kommentar
Del på andre sites

  • 0

@mfhl Home Assistant integrationen til IHC er lavet af Jens, som har dingus.dk Han kan bedre end mig svare på spørgsmål om integrationen til Home Assistant.


Jeg gjorde følgende for at få alarmen og andre IHC ting til at virke:

  1. Manuel installation af hans beta kode i Home Assistant folder fra hans github her, hvor der også er beskrivelse af, hvordan man gør det. Se dette link.
  2. Brug af Home Assistant UI til at oprette forbindelse til IHC Controlleren
  3. Indsættelse af min egen kode i automations.yaml. Koden er vist herunder:
    
    ##########   Alarm   ##########
    Sync states from IHC
      - alias: 'Arm alarm night if skalalarm armed by IHC'
        trigger:
          platform: state
          entity_id: binary_sensor.ihcalarmmodeskal
          to: "on"
        action:
          service: alarm_control_panel.alarm_arm_night
          data:
            entity_id: alarm_control_panel.ihc_alarm
    
      - alias: 'Arm alarm away if totalalarm armed by IHC'
        trigger:
          platform: state
          entity_id: switch.ihcalarmmodefuld
          to: "on"
        action:
          service: alarm_control_panel.alarm_arm_away
          data:
            entity_id: alarm_control_panel.ihc_alarm
    
      - alias: 'Disarm alarm if disarmed by IHC'
        trigger:
          - platform: state
            entity_id: binary_sensor.ihcalarmmodeskal
            to: "off"
          - platform: state
            entity_id: switch.ihcalarmmodefuld
            to: "off"
        action:
          service: alarm_control_panel.alarm_disarm
          data:
            entity_id: alarm_control_panel.ihc_alarm
            code: 1234
    
    Sync states to IHC
    Skalsikring kan kun ændres med kip
      - alias: 'If Disarmed then send disarm skalalarm to IHC'
        trigger:
          platform: state
          entity_id: alarm_control_panel.ihc_alarm
          to: "disarmed"
        condition:
          - condition: state
            entity_id: binary_sensor.ihcalarmmodeskal
            state: "on"
        action:
          service: switch.turn_on
          data:
            entity_id: switch.ihcalarmstatusskalsikring
    
      - alias: 'If Disarmed then send disarm totalalarm to IHC'
        trigger:
          platform: state
          entity_id: alarm_control_panel.ihc_alarm
          to: "disarmed"
        action:
          service: switch.turn_off
          data:
            entity_id: switch.ihcalarmmodefuld
    
    Skalsikring kan kun ændres med kip
      - alias: 'If armed night then send arm skalalarm to IHC'
        trigger:
          platform: state
          entity_id: alarm_control_panel.ihc_alarm
          to: "armed_night"
        condition:
          - condition: state
            entity_id: binary_sensor.ihcalarmmodeskal
            state: "off"
        action:
          service: switch.turn_on
          data:
            entity_id: switch.ihcalarmstatusskalsikring
    
      - alias: 'If arm away then send totalalarm to IHC'
        trigger:
          platform: state
          entity_id: alarm_control_panel.ihc_alarm
          to: "armed_away"
        action:
          service: switch.turn_on
          data:
            entity_id: switch.ihcalarmmodefuld


    Jeg har selv investeret nogle timer i at lære, hvordan tingene hænger sammen for at komme i mål. Det tænker jeg også du bliver nødt til :-)

    God fornøjelse.

Link til kommentar
Del på andre sites

  • 0
15 timer siden, Kim carlsen skrev:

@EjvindHald har du magnetkontakter i HA, eks zigbee, koblet sammen med IHC alarm? Jeg er lidt i tvivl om det giver falske alarmer, så har været tilbageholden med at binde dem sammen.

Falske alarmer har jeg brugt en del tid på at eliminere, men det er mest udendørs bevægelsessensorer.

Hele min installation er trådført inkl. magnetkontakter, så jeg har ikke erfaring med kombi med zigbee magnetkontakter til alarm.

I øvrigt bruger jeg openHAB + Homekit og ikke Home Assistant. Mit eksempel med Home Assistant var, fordi jeg afprøvede HA, som virker fint sammen med IHC og andet.

Link til kommentar
Del på andre s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gæst
Svar på dette spørgsmål

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loader...
 Share

×
×
  • Tilføj...

Important Information

Privatlivspolitik og We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.

1200x630bb.png

ok